> > > > Is it doesn't need to reset with reset_contrl_reset()? > > Hello, Chanwoo! > > It's reset just before the clk_round_rate() invocation, hence there > shouldn't be a need to reset it second time. Ah... I was looking the wrong code. Plus I don't really know this code very well. If clk_prepare_enable() fails, then I would have assumed we need to call reset_control_deassert(). I would have assumed the reset_control_assert() and _deassert() functions were paired. So what I'm suggesting is something like the following: (I'll resend this if it's correct). [PATCH] PM / devfreq: tegra30: Add missing reset_control_deassert() If clk_prepare_enable() fails then probe needs to call the reset_control_deassert() function.
